Treasury accused of ‘being nasty’ to bats in pursuit of growth


Environmentalists have accused the government of “being nasty” to bats and wrongly suggesting that the animals are holding back economic growth. As part of chancellor Rachel Reeves’s “radical shake-up” of red tape to promote growth, officials said on Monday that guidance on protecting bats will be looked at afresh. “It should not be the case that to convert a garage or outbuilding you need to wade through hundreds of pages of guidance on bats,” the Treasury said in a statement.
